Unlocking Network Mastery — The Strategic Power of the CCNP ENCOR 350-401 Certification

The Cisco Certified Network Professional Enterprise Core examination, designated as the 350-401 ENCOR, serves as the mandatory core examination for the CCNP Enterprise certification and simultaneously functions as the qualifying examination for the CCIE Enterprise Infrastructure and CCIE Enterprise Wireless expert-level certifications. This dual role makes the ENCOR examination one of the most strategically significant credentials in Cisco’s certification portfolio, sitting at the precise intersection where professional-level expertise meets expert-level aspiration. Pass the 350-501 Exam with Precision and Focused Practice

The 350-501 examination, carrying the official title Implementing and Operating Cisco Service Provider Core Technologies and commonly referred to by its acronym SPCOR, occupies the same structural position in the CCNP Service Provider certification pathway that ENCOR occupies in the CCNP Enterprise track. It is the core examination that must be passed alongside any one of the available concentration examinations to earn the CCNP Service Provider credential. Getting Started with the Cisco 200-901 Associate Certification

The Cisco 200-901 DevNet Associate examination, carrying the official title “Developing Applications and Automating Workflows Using Cisco Core Platforms,” represents the entry point into Cisco’s programmability and automation certification pathway. It validates foundational knowledge across software development practices, network automation concepts, Cisco platform APIs, application deployment principles, and infrastructure programmability.
